Output 041c3c66b0873e7a7a6de3f00b9d4011f17e8564687e15d168534c0c2c8daaa9:2

value
1024201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ae8d42e1efc5e550f2cd58c7c85aa7e1d12c490 OP_EQUAL
address
35buDqAcFuwKWBo4XMS6qtt2RnbfzkrjuS
transaction
041c3c66b0873e7a7a6de3f00b9d4011f17e8564687e15d168534c0c2c8daaa9
confirmations
289874
spent
true